+ or you could use ```customize``` to add a repository:
+
+ ```
+ M-x customize-variable [RET] package-archives
+ ```
+
+ and add MELPA or Marmalade, for example:
+
+ ```
+ marmalade http://marmalade-repo.org/packages/
+ ```
+
+ and then use package install to install it:
+
+ ```
+ M-x package-install [RET] scala-mode2 [RET]
+ ```
